The sciences are not sectarian. People do not persecute each other on account of disagreements in mathematics. Families are not divided about botany, and astronomy does not even tend to make a man hate his father and mother. It is what people do not know, that they persecute each other about. Science will bring, not a sword, but peace.

Scientific "facts" are taught at a very early age and in the very same manner in which religious "facts" were taught only a century ago. There is no attempt to waken the critical abilities of the pupil so that he may be able to see things in perspective. At the universities the situation is even worse, for indoctrination is here carried out in a much more systematic manner. Criticism is not entirely absent. Society, for example, and its institutions, are criticised most severely and often most unfairly... But science is excepted from the criticism. In society at large the judgment of the scientist is received with the same reverence as the judgement of bishops and cardinals was accepted not too long ago. The move towards "demythologization," for example, is largely motivated by the wish to avoid any clash between Christianity and scientific ideas. If such a clash occurs, then science is certainly right and Christianity wrong. Pursue this investigation further and you will see that science has now become as oppressive as the ideologies it had once to fight. Do not be misled by the fact that today hardly anyone gets killed for joining a scientific heresy. This has nothing to do with science. It has something to do with the general quality of our civilization. Heretics in science are still made to suffer from the most severe sanctions this relatively tolerant civilization has to offer.

Ethnocentrism, xenophobia and nationalism are these days rife in many parts of the world. Government repression of unpopular views is still widespread. False or misleading memories are inculcated. For the defenders of such attitudes, science is disturb­ing. It claims access to truths that are largely independent of ethnic or cultural biases. By its very nature, science transcends national boundaries. Put scientists working in the same field of study together in a room and even if they share no common spoken language, they will find a way to communicate. Science itself is a transnational language. Scientists are naturally cosmo­politan in attitude and are more likely to see through efforts to divide the human family into many small and warring factions. 'There is no national science,' said the Russian playwright Anton Chekhov, 'just as there is no national multiplication table.' (Likewise, for many, there is no such thing as a national religion, although the religion of nationalism has millions of adherents.)

All knowledge, not only that of the natural world, can be used for evil as well as good: and in all ages there continue to be people who think that its fruit should be forbidden. Does the future wlfare, therefore, of mankind depend of a refusal of science and a more intensive study of the Sermon on the Mount? There are others who hold the contray opinion, that more and more of science and its applications alone can bring prosperity and happiness to men. Both of these extremes views seem to me entirely wrong - though the second is the more perilous as more likely to be commonly accepted. The so-called conflict between science and religion is usually about words, too often the words of their unbalanced advocates: the reality lies somewhere in between. "Completeness and dignity", to use Tyndall's phrase, are brought to man by three main channels, first by the religiouos sentiment and its embodiment of ethical principles, secondly by the influence of what is beautiful in nature, human personality, or art, and thirdly, by the pursuit of scientific truth and its resolute use in improving human life. Some suppose that religion and beauty are incompatible: others, that the aesthetic has no relation to the scientific sense: both seem to me just as mistaken as those who hold that the scientific and the religious spirit are necessarily opposed. Co-operation is required, not conflict: for science can be used to express and apply the principles of ethics, and those principles themselves can guide the behaviour of scientific men: while the appreciation of what is good and beautiful can provide to both a vision of encouragement. Is there really then any special ethical dilemma which we scientific men, as distinct from other people, have to meet? I think not: unless it be to convince ourselves humbly that we are just like others in having moral issues to face. It is true that integrity of thought is the absolute condition of oour work, and that judgments of value must never be allowed to deflect our judgements of fact. But in this we are not unique. It is true that scientific research has opened up the possibility of unprecedented good, or unlimited harm, for manking: but the use is made of it depends in the end on the moral judgments of the whole community of men. It is totally impossible noew to reverse the process of discovery: it will certainly go on. To help to guide its use aright is not a scientific dilemma, but the honourable and compelling duty of a good citizen.
